Your Challenges:
Primary Responsibilities:
Continuous improvement / LEAN across S&S domains: 30%
Lead of S&S end-to-end process optimization to drive enterprise transformation
Foster continuous improvement mindset and animate continuous improvement network and initiatives across S&S
Lead and deploy LEAN practices (5S, VSM, standard agenda…) in all the S&S domains, including the Airbus Operating System (AOS) deployment
Generate, identify, and measure opportunities for improvements initiatives including identification of action leverages, risk and management issues of proposed changes, business case creation, financial analysis and viability
Lead and drive the progress and performance improvement network, deploy and maintain the level of control of activities
Build and manage yearly LEAN and continuous improvement deployment plan execution (including management practices and ImpAct)
Lead operational and improvement teams to build and execute their Continuous Improvement plans, focusing on business priorities, performance, customers and employees irritants
Provide methodological support, training and coaching upon function / domain requests on LEAN standards, methods and tools
